Key Accounting Practices for Business Success

Adopting sound accounting practices is crucial for gaining insights into your business's financial position. These practices help in making informed decisions, managing resources efficiently, and ensuring compliance with regulatory standards. Here are some essential accounting practices that can significantly impact your business's financial health:

  • Regular Financial Audits: Conducting periodic financial audits allows you to assess your business's financial standing accurately. This practice helps identify discrepancies, ensures compliance, and provides a clear picture of your financial health. Regular audits can also uncover opportunities for cost savings and efficiency improvements.
  • Comprehensive Financial Reporting: Detailed financial reports,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ements, are vital for tracking your business's performance. These reports provide insights into revenue trends, expense patterns, and profitability, enabling you to make data-driven decisions.
  • Budgeting and Forecasting: Creating and adhering to a budget is a fundamental aspect of financial management. Budgeting helps allocate resources effectively and ensures that your spending aligns with your business goals. Additionally, forecasting future financial performance allows you to anticipate challenges and seize growth opportunities.
  • Tax Planning and Compliance: Navigating the complexities of tax regulations is crucial for minimizing liabilities and avoiding penalties. Effective tax planning involves understanding applicable tax laws, taking advantage of deductions, and ensuring timely filing. Staying compliant not only reduces risks but also enhances your business's credibility.
  • Cash Flow Management: Maintaining a healthy cash flow is essential for meeting operational expenses and investing in growth. Implementing strategies to optimize cash flow, such as timely invoicing and efficient inventory management, ensures that your business remains financially stable.

Strategic Financial Strategies for Long-Term Success

Beyond basic accounting practices, implementing strategic financial strategies is key to achieving long-term business success. These strategies focus on optimizing resource allocation, enhancing profitability, and fostering sustainable growth. Consider the following approaches:

  • Investment in Technology: Leveraging technology can streamline accounting processes, reduce errors, and enhance efficiency. Investing in accounting software and automation tools enables you to manage financial data more effectively, freeing up time for strategic decision-making.
  • Risk Management: Identifying and mitigating financial risks is crucial for protecting your business's assets. Developing a comprehensive risk management plan involves assessing potential threats, implementing safeguards, and regularly reviewing your risk exposure.
  • Diversification of Revenue Streams: Relying on a single source of income can be risky. Diversifying your revenue streams by exploring new markets, products, or services can enhance financial stability and open up new growth opportunities.
  • Cost Control Measures: Implementing cost control measures helps optimize expenses without compromising quality. Regularly reviewing and renegotiating supplier contracts, streamlining operations, and reducing waste are effective ways to manage costs.
  • Building Financial Reserves: Establishing financial reserves provides a safety net during economic downturns or unexpected challenges. Setting aside a portion of profits as reserves ensures that your business can weather financial uncertainties.

Leveraging Financial Data for Business Growth

Incorporating robust accounting practices into your business operations not only aids in financial stability but also provides a wealth of data that can drive strategic growth. By analyzing this data, you can uncover trends, identify opportunities, and make informed decisions that propel your business towards sustained success.

  • Data-Driven Decision Making: Utilizing financial data to guide your decision-making process ensures that your strategies are grounded in reality. This approach minimizes risks associated with gut-feeling decisions and maximizes the potential for achieving your business objectives.
  • Identifying Profit Centers: Analyzing financial reports helps pinpoint which areas of your business are most profitable. By focusing on these profit centers, you can allocate resources more effectively and explore ways to enhance their performance.
  • Cost-Benefit Analysis: Regularly conducting cost-benefit analyses enables you to evaluate the financial implications of potential investments or changes in operations. This method ensures that every financial decision contributes positively to your business's bottom line.
  • Market Trend Analysis: Understanding market trends through financial data allows you to anticipate shifts in demand and adapt your business strategies accordingly. Staying ahead of market changes can give you a competitive edge and boost your business's financial health.

Enhancing Financial Strategies with Technology

In today's digital age, technology plays a pivotal role in transforming accounting practices and financial strategies. By embracing technological advancements, you can streamline operations, improve accuracy, and enhance your business's overall financial health.

  • Cloud-Based Accounting Solutions: Adopting cloud-based accounting software offers real-time access to financial data, facilitating collaboration and decision-making. These solutions also provide enhanced security, ensuring that your sensitive financial information is protected.
  • Automated Bookkeeping: Automation reduces manual errors and frees up valuable time for focusing on strategic initiatives. Implementing automated bookkeeping systems ensures that your financial records are consistently up-to-date and accurate.
  • Advanced Analytics Tools: Leveraging advanced analytics tools enables you to gain deeper insights into your financial data. These tools can help identify patterns, forecast future trends, and provide actionable recommendations for improving financial performance.
  • Mobile Accounting Applications: Mobile apps allow you to manage your business's finances on the go. With features like expense tracking and invoicing, these applications offer convenience and flexibility, empowering you to stay on top of your financial activities anytime, anywhere.
